Frequently Asked Questions
- What is PR's current dividend yield?
- PR (Permian Resources Corporation) currently has a dividend yield of 2.65%. This means for every $10,000 invested, you would receive approximately $265 per year in dividend income before taxes.
- How much PR do I need to make $1,000 per month in dividends?
- To earn $1,000 per month ($12,000/year) from PR at its current yield of 2.65%, you would need approximately $452,830 invested. With dividend reinvestment and growth, you may need less over time.
- Does PR pay monthly dividends?
- No, PR pays dividends quarterly (4 times per year). You can build monthly income by combining it with other stocks that pay in different months.
- Is PR's dividend safe?
- PR's payout ratio is 40.9%, which is generally considered safe. The company retains enough earnings to sustain and potentially grow its dividend.
